Output 38a4c5a15d430e473a29a3bece3961201884f09631e7a9665d568cbd5ac35cfa:4

value
956960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fca02ca92920547ef2eea452163843abe3fa0e6 OP_EQUAL
address
3Bt6voPP8Dvz98kgbdo4iuoWukfM2UvBKU
transaction
38a4c5a15d430e473a29a3bece3961201884f09631e7a9665d568cbd5ac35cfa
spent
true